Key Differences

Product A is a 4" handwheel with a 1/2" shaft bore and a slightly lower listed price tier; Product B is a 5" heavy-duty handwheel with the same 1/2" bore but larger diameter intended for machinery and table-saw parts. Pick A if you want the more compact 4" replacement at a lower price tier; pick B if you need a larger, heavier-duty 5" wheel for broader machinery use
